def route(self,dest,verbose=None):
if isinstance(dest, list) and dest:
dest = dest[0]
if dest in self.cache:
return self.cache[dest]
if verbose is None:
verbose=conf.verb
# Transform "192.168.*.1-5" to one IP of the set
dst = dest.split("/")[0]
dst = dst.replace("*","0")
while True:
l = dst.find("-")
if l < 0:
break
m = (dst[l:]+".").find(".")
dst = dst[:l]+dst[l+m:]
dst = atol(dst)
pathes=[]
for d,m,gw,i,a,me in self.routes:
if not a: # some interfaces may not currently be connected
continue
aa = atol(a)
if aa == dst:
pathes.append(
(0xffffffff, 1, (scapy.consts.LOOPBACK_INTERFACE, a, "0.0.0.0"))
)
if (dst & m) == (d & m):
pathes.append((m, me, (i,a,gw)))
if not pathes:
if verbose:
warning("No route found (no default route?)")
return scapy.consts.LOOPBACK_INTERFACE, "0.0.0.0", "0.0.0.0"
# Choose the more specific route
# Sort by greatest netmask
pathes.sort(key=lambda x: x[0], reverse=True)
# Get all pathes having the (same) greatest mask
pathes = [i for i in pathes if i[0] == pathes[0][0]]
# Tie-breaker: Metrics
pathes.sort(key=lambda x: x[1])
# Return interface
ret = pathes[0][2]
self.cache[dest] = ret
return ret
